The Everett Alvarez Eagles didn't have too much trouble with the Greenfield Bruins on Friday as they won 23-6.
The critical scores for Everett Alvarez came from Devin Pedersen, Sebastian Jones, and Isaiah Reyes.
Everett Alvarez's win bumped their record up to 6-2. As for Greenfield, their defeat was their fifth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 0-8.
Looking ahead, Everett Alvarez will head out to challenge Stevenson at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day. The two teams have allowed few points on average (the Eagles 13.8, the Pirates 10.5) so any points scored will be well earned. As for Greenfield, they will be playing in front of their home fans against King City at 7:30 p.m. on Thursday. The Mustangs will roll in looking for their eighth straight victory, something the Bruins surely won't give up without a fight.
